Ernst A. Ekker(1937-1999)

  • Writer
IMDbProStarmeterSee rank
Ernst A. Ekker was born on 4 March 1937 in Idar-Oberstein, Rhineland-Palatinate, Germany. He was a writer, known for Die ersten Tage (1971), Der letzte Werkelmann (1972) and Solo für einen Menschenfreund (1969). He died on 18 May 1999 in Ravensburg, Baden-Würtemberg, Germany.
